• Yanmar, Dipstick, 42130-501210
Yanmar Part #: 42130-501210

Dipstick

Write a review

Please login or register to review

Yanmar, Dipstick, 42130-501210

  • Brand: Yanmar
  • Product Code: 42130-501210
  • $38.00